for++和for--
在 C++ 中,for
循环是一种常用的控制流程语句,用于重复执行一段代码。++
和 --
是 C++ 中的递增和递减运算符,常用于控制 for
循环的迭代次数。
for
循环的基本结构
for (初始化表达式; 条件表达式; 迭代表达式) {
// 循环体
}
++
和 --
运算符++
运算符: 用于将变量的值加 1。--
运算符: 用于将变量的值减 1。++
和 --
运算符有两种形式:前缀形式(++i
)和后缀形式(i++
)。
for
循环中使用 ++
和 --
在 for
循环的迭代表达式中,++
和 --
运算符通常用来更新循环控制变量。
// 例子1:从0循环到9
for (int i = 0; i < 10; i++) {
cout << i << " ";
}
// 例子2:从9循环到0
for (int i = 9; i >= 0; i--) {
cout << i << " ";
}
注意:
for
循环中,++i
和 i++
的效果通常是一样的,但如果在表达式中多次使用同一个变量,那么前缀和后缀形式就会产生不同的结果。++i
和 i++
在 for
循环中通常可以互换,但为了代码的可读性和一致性,建议选择一种形式并贯彻始终。for
循环和 ++
运算符计算 1 到 10 的和
int sum = 0;
for (int i = 1; i <= 10; i++) {
sum += i;
}
cout << "Sum: " << sum << endl;
for
循环和 ++
、--
运算符是 C++ 中非常基础且常用的语法。通过灵活运用这些语法,可以实现各种各样的循环控制。
关键点:
for
循环的三个组成部分:初始化、条件、迭代。++
和 --
运算符用于递增和递减变量。for
循环中使用 ++
和 --
更新循环变量。希望这个解释对你有帮助!
如果你还有其他问题,欢迎随时提问。
想了解更多关于 C++ 的知识,可以参考以下方面:
关键词: C++, for循环, ++, --, 递增, 递减, 循环控制